Before installing the new manifolds, I sanded off as much of the soot & rust as I could from the mating surfaces. Later, I rinsed them with brake cleaner & coated them with common chassis grease, just like Ford did at the factory. I also rinsed out the open bolt holes, and the EGR inverted flare nut, lubed it with penetrating oil, and coated its threads with anti-seize.

Later, I learned that the head surface was too pitted for the grease to seal, so I had to pull both manifolds off again & re-seal with red RTV.
